位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el数据 > 文章详情

excel 数据类型 函数

作者:excel百科网
|
262人看过
发布时间:2026-01-12 21:43:11
标签:
Excel 数据类型与函数详解:从基础到高级的全面指南在Excel中,数据类型和函数是构建高效数据处理流程的核心。无论是数据录入、统计分析,还是复杂的数据运算,都离不开这些基本要素。本文将深入探讨Excel中的数据类型及其相关函数,帮
excel 数据类型 函数
Excel 数据类型与函数详解:从基础到高级的全面指南
在Excel中,数据类型和函数是构建高效数据处理流程的核心。无论是数据录入、统计分析,还是复杂的数据运算,都离不开这些基本要素。本文将深入探讨Excel中的数据类型及其相关函数,帮助用户更高效地利用Excel进行数据处理与分析。
一、Excel 数据类型概述
Excel 数据类型是数据在系统中存储和处理的基本单位。根据其存储方式和用途,Excel支持多种数据类型,主要包括以下几类:
1. 数值型数据
数值型数据包括整数、浮点数、百分比、货币等。这些数据可以直接进行加减乘除、求和等数学运算。例如,100、200、50%、1000元等。
2. 文本型数据
文本型数据用于存储文字、名称、地址等非数字内容。Excel支持字符串、日期、时间等多种文本格式。例如,“北京”、“2024年3月1日”、“20:30”。
3. 逻辑型数据
逻辑型数据表示真假值,通常用“TRUE”和“FALSE”表示。这些数据在条件判断、公式运算中非常重要。
4. 错误值型数据
错误值用于表示计算过程中出现的错误,如DIV/0!、VALUE!、REF!等。这些错误值在数据验证和错误处理中起到关键作用。
5. 日期和时间型数据
日期和时间型数据用于记录时间点,Excel支持日期和时间的计算、比较、转换等操作。例如,2024年3月1日、20:30:00、12:00。
6. 特殊数据类型
Excel还支持一些特殊数据类型,如布尔型、空值、引用等。这些数据在特定情况下用于控制计算逻辑。
二、数值型数据的处理与函数应用
数值型数据在Excel中具有很强的计算能力,常见的处理函数包括:
1. SUM()
用于计算一组数值的总和。例如:`=SUM(A1:A10)`,计算A1到A10的和。
2. AVERAGE()
用于计算一组数值的平均值。例如:`=AVERAGE(B1:B10)`,计算B1到B10的平均值。
3. MAX()
用于计算一组数值的最大值。例如:`=MAX(C1:C10)`,计算C1到C10的最大值。
4. MIN()
用于计算一组数值的最小值。例如:`=MIN(D1:D10)`,计算D1到D10的最小值。
5. COUNT()
用于统计一组数据中包含多少个数值。例如:`=COUNT(E1:E10)`,统计E1到E10中有多少个数值。
6. ROUND()
用于对数值进行四舍五入。例如:`=ROUND(123.456, 2)`,将123.456四舍五入到小数点后两位,结果为123.46。
7. ABS()
用于返回一个数的绝对值。例如:`=ABS(-100)`,结果为100。
8. IF()
用于条件判断,根据条件返回不同的结果。例如:`=IF(A1>50, "高", "低")`,如果A1大于50,返回“高”,否则返回“低”。
9. AND()
用于判断多个条件是否同时满足。例如:`=AND(A1>50, B1<100)`,如果A1大于50且B1小于100,返回TRUE。
10. OR()
用于判断多个条件是否至少有一个满足。例如:`=OR(A1>50, B1<100)`,如果A1大于50或B1小于100,返回TRUE。
三、文本型数据的处理与函数应用
文本型数据在Excel中用于存储和处理文字、名称、地址等信息。常见的处理函数包括:
1. CONCATENATE()
用于将多个文本字符串合并成一个字符串。例如:`=CONCATENATE("北京", "市")`,结果为“北京市”。
2. TEXT()
用于将数值格式化为特定的文本格式。例如:`=TEXT(2024, "yyyy-mm-dd")`,结果为“2024-03-01”。
3. LEFT()
用于提取文本字符串的前若干个字符。例如:`=LEFT("北京", 2)`,结果为“北”。
4. RIGHT()
用于提取文本字符串的后若干个字符。例如:`=RIGHT("北京", 2)`,结果为“京”。
5. MID()
用于提取文本字符串的中间部分。例如:`=MID("北京", 2, 1)`,结果为“京”。
6. LEN()
用于返回文本字符串的长度。例如:`=LEN("北京")`,结果为4。
7. SUBSTITUTE()
用于替换文本中的特定字符。例如:`=SUBSTITUTE("北京", "北", "南")`,结果为“南京”。
8. TRIM()
用于去除文本字符串两端的空格。例如:`=TRIM(" 北京 ")`,结果为“北京”。
9. REPLACE()
用于替换文本字符串中的特定部分。例如:`=REPLACE("北京", 2, 1, "市")`,结果为“北市”。
10. SEARCH()
用于查找文本字符串中的特定子字符串。例如:`=SEARCH("市", "北京")`,结果为1(表示“市”在“北京”中第1个位置)。
四、逻辑型数据的处理与函数应用
逻辑型数据在Excel中用于条件判断和逻辑运算,常见的处理函数包括:
1. IF()
用于条件判断,根据条件返回不同的结果。例如:`=IF(A1>50, "高", "低")`,如果A1大于50,返回“高”,否则返回“低”。
2. AND()
用于判断多个条件是否同时满足。例如:`=AND(A1>50, B1<100)`,如果A1大于50且B1小于100,返回TRUE。
3. OR()
用于判断多个条件是否至少有一个满足。例如:`=OR(A1>50, B1<100)`,如果A1大于50或B1小于100,返回TRUE。
4. NOT()
用于对逻辑值取反。例如:`=NOT(A1>50)`,如果A1大于50,返回FALSE。
5. IFERROR()
用于处理错误值,返回指定的值。例如:`=IFERROR(A1/B1, "错误")`,如果A1/B1出现错误,返回“错误”。
6. ISERROR()
用于判断某个值是否为错误值。例如:`=ISERROR(A1/B1)`,如果A1/B1出现错误,返回TRUE。
7. ISBLANK()
用于判断某个单元格是否为空。例如:`=ISBLANK(A1)`,如果A1为空,返回TRUE。
8. ISNUMBER()
用于判断某个值是否为数字。例如:`=ISNUMBER(A1)`,如果A1是数字,返回TRUE。
五、日期和时间型数据的处理与函数应用
日期和时间型数据在Excel中用于记录时间点,常见的处理函数包括:
1. TODAY()
用于返回当前日期。例如:`=TODAY()`,返回当前日期。
2. NOW()
用于返回当前日期和时间。例如:`=NOW()`,返回当前日期和时间。
3. DATE()
用于创建特定日期。例如:`=DATE(2024, 3, 1)`,返回2024年3月1日。
4. TIME()
用于创建特定时间。例如:`=TIME(12, 30, 0)`,返回12:30:00。
5. DATEDIF()
用于计算两个日期之间的天数差。例如:`=DATEDIF(A1, B1, "D")`,返回A1和B1之间相隔的天数。
6. DATEDIF()
用于计算两个日期之间的天数差。例如:`=DATEDIF(A1, B1, "D")`,返回A1和B1之间相隔的天数。
7. DATEVALUE()
用于将文本格式的日期转换为数值格式。例如:`=DATEVALUE("2024-03-01")`,返回2024年3月1日。
8. TIMEVALUE()
用于将文本格式的时间转换为数值格式。例如:`=TIMEVALUE("12:30:00")`,返回12:30:00。
9. SUM()
用于计算日期和时间的差值。例如:`=SUM(D1:D10)`,计算D1到D10的和。
10. AVERAGE()
用于计算日期和时间的平均值。例如:`=AVERAGE(D1:D10)`,计算D1到D10的平均值。
六、错误值型数据的处理与函数应用
错误值型数据在Excel中用于表示计算过程中出现的错误,常见的处理函数包括:
1. DIV/0!
用于表示除以零的错误。例如:`=10/0`,返回DIV/0!。
2. VALUE!
用于表示数值类型不一致。例如:`=A1+B1`,如果A1是文本,B1是数值,返回VALUE!。
3. REF!
用于表示引用无效。例如:`=A1/B1`,如果B1是空单元格,返回REF!。
4. NAME?
用于表示名称错误。例如:`=SUM(A1:B1)`,如果A1或B1是空单元格,返回NAME?。
5. NUM!
用于表示数值计算结果超出范围。例如:`=1000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000
推荐文章
相关文章
推荐URL
Excel表格数据最佳匹配的实用指南在数据处理中,Excel 是一个不可或缺的工具。无论是企业财务报表、市场调研数据,还是用户行为分析,Excel 都能提供高效、直观的处理方式。其中,数据匹配是一项基础而重要的技能。本文将从多个角度深
2026-01-12 21:42:35
324人看过
Excel数据对应自动分类:从基础到进阶的实践指南在数据处理领域,Excel作为一款广泛应用的工具,其强大的数据处理能力在企业、科研、教育等多个领域中不可或缺。然而,对于大量数据的分类任务,若手动进行,往往效率低下且容易出错。因此,掌
2026-01-12 21:42:22
71人看过
Excel论文问卷数据输入:从数据采集到分析的全流程详解在学术研究中,问卷数据的输入是研究过程中的关键环节,尤其是在使用Excel进行数据处理和分析时,掌握正确的输入方法和技巧至关重要。本文将从问卷设计、数据录入、数据清洗、数据整理、
2026-01-12 21:42:14
375人看过
Excel表格合并数据匹配:深度解析与实战技巧Excel作为办公软件中最为常用的数据处理工具之一,其强大的功能使得用户在日常工作中能够高效地完成数据整理、分析和处理。其中,“合并数据匹配”是一个极具实用价值的功能,它可以帮助用户将多个
2026-01-12 21:42:09
85人看过
热门推荐
热门专题:
资讯中心: